I think Jones definitely has an argument to crack into the previous group but otherwise, this is a who’s who of disappointments from the 2020 NBA Draft. The good news is that guys ike Hayes, Toppin and Okoro still have time to improve, but so far, it’s safe to say that none of them would stay in their original lottery positions.

You can also see that RJ Hampton dropped out of the 1st-round altogether in favor of a few older players who are getting minutes on better teams.

The Detroit Pistons have staked part of their future on the 2020 NBA Draft, but so far it hasn’t really worked out, though Wiseman has been promising, and Stewart looks like he’ll be a solid role player for years to come.
